Ingredients:
1 (10.5 oz) can of cream of condensed chicken soup
1 c water or chicken broth
1 oz. dry ranch salad dressing and seasoning mix
4 skinless chicken breasts
Directions:
1. Apply cooking spray to the bottom of the slow cooker.
2. Add the chicken into the prepared slow cooker and arrange them in a single layer.
3. Add the chicken soup over the chicken and spread it evenly.
4. Add Ranch seasoning and water.
5. Cover and seal the slow cooker, then cook everything for about 7 hours on a low setting.
6. Open the slow cooker, then transfer the chicken onto a clean plate.
7. Use two forks to shred the chicken into small pieces.
8. Put the shredded back into the slow cooker, then stir until well combined.
9. Serve right away over mashed potatoes. Enjoy!
Note:
Garnish with your preferred herbs.
Don’t forget to spoon the delicious gravy over each serving.
